About Nancy S. Layman at a glance

Nancy S. Layman is a employment, environmental, and health care attorney practicing in South Carolina. They have 34+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 1992. Admitted to practice in South Carolina (1992), U.S. Supreme Court (1998), and U.S. Court of Appeals Fourth Circuit (1999). Educated at University of South Carolina (J.D., 1992) and Otterbein College (B.A. University, 1963).

Jurisdictional Context

Why local counsel matters in South Carolina

Practicing law in South Carolina. Legal matters in South Carolina are governed by state-specific rules of civil and criminal procedure, statutes of limitations, and substantive law. An attorney licensed in South Carolina brings working knowledge of local procedural deadlines, judicial practices in this andnue, and the substantive law that applies to cases brought here. Out-of-state attorneys generally cannot represent clients in South Carolina courts without local counsel or pro hac vice admission.
